How do you know I’m being truthful? I guess there’s really no way to know…aside from the fact that I’ll call out bull shit SEOs as follows:
- Are subscriptions to “monthly submissions services” a scam? YES!
- Is “submission software” a good thing? NO
- Will a reputable SEO ever call or e-mail you to offer their services? Not typically…do your homework!
- Will a reputable SEO offer “guaranteed results in 7-10 days…”? NEVER! (Hey, if Matt Cutts can’t guarantee page one in Google for half a million bucks, who the hell are these people kidding???)
- Are offers of “10,000 incoming links in within 48 hours…” and “Page 1 in Google…” legit? HELL NO!
